New Georgia Laws Hit This Week. Here Are the Ones That Matter
GEORGIA β More than 120 new laws took effect July 1. The DREAMS Scholarship launches this fall with $325 million in state funding, giving Georgia its first-ever need-based college scholarship. The penny is gone at the register β cash transactions now round to the nearest nickel. K-8 students are now phone-free during the school day. And Henry County HOA homeowners get new rights limiting attorney fees effective immediately.
Why it matters: These changes affect your wallet, your kids' classroom, and your college financial aid this fall. Full breakdown at Capitol Beat β
Data Centers Are Moving Into Rural Georgia. Henry County Is Already Ground Zero
GEORGIA β A new GPB analysis finds 129 community groups in rural counties across the country are actively fighting data center development, with concerns about water, electricity costs, and rural character. Georgia is one of the nation's top hotspots. Henry County Board Chair Carlotta Harrell said the county was caught off guard by the Equinix data center approved in Hampton, and the Water Authority has since passed new ordinances requiring feasibility studies before supplying water to major new users. Seven in 10 Americans now oppose data centers in their area according to a May Gallup poll.
Why it matters: Henry County isn't alone in this fight. Communities across Georgia are asking the same question: who decides how much growth is too much? Read the full GPB analysis β
A McDonough Realtor Is Opening a Dessert Bar. And It Sounds Incredible
MCDONOUGH β Local realtor Simmi Patel is making a sweet pivot. Patel is bringing Decadent Coffee & Dessert Bar to 99 Hwy 81, Suite 104 in McDonough, a franchise concept she discovered in Warner Robins and immediately fell in love with. The menu features cakes, cheesecakes, pies, brownies, cookies, cannolis, pastries, cold brew, lattes, and matchas. Her main goal is simple: bring a quality coffee shop to McDonough, a city she says doesn't have enough of them.
Why it matters: McDonough keeps attracting new food and beverage concepts and this one is locally owned. A Henry County resident is bringing it here because she believes in this community. Read more at What Now Atlanta β

Got a Street Light Out in Stockbridge? Here's How to Get It Fixed
STOCKBRIDGE β A dark street light isn't just an inconvenience; it's a safety issue, especially heading into summer evenings and holiday weekends. Stockbridge residents have two easy ways to report a street light outage. You can report it directly through SeeClickFix at seeclickfix.com/stockbridge, the same free app the city uses for non-emergency requests like potholes and graffiti. Or you can report it directly to Georgia Power online at georgiapower.com or by calling 1-888-660-5890, Monday through Friday, 7 a.m. to 9 p.m.
Why it matters: Most residents don't know how simple it is to get a street light fixed. One report is all it takes and your neighbors will thank you for it. Learn more about Stockbridge Public Works services β
